Output 13c62bf2d85c69817c384e18aa6e55137f56f106e57c34a44e80f07c2920f3dc:0

value
11622878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 566ac3327b8f25bba8f11ed909094170411717d1 OP_EQUAL
address
MFn6Ev3dAMj1oMEHZsJgwgqNVw49Q3tNw4
transaction
13c62bf2d85c69817c384e18aa6e55137f56f106e57c34a44e80f07c2920f3dc
spent
true